Output 00cabb425931efe009ef5c92555fd4da07d40ade403c6c8cf27da9a8f9e17635:5

value
39905982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8aac3e79ce9166527f25a48e1f2a1d149e55e9 OP_EQUAL
address
3HWcwtRcNrVtYHXbaepELEd5XdP7jvQi7d
transaction
00cabb425931efe009ef5c92555fd4da07d40ade403c6c8cf27da9a8f9e17635
confirmations
274215
spent
true